Foreword
Justice Virender Singh
Chief Justice, High Court of Jharkhand cum Patron-in-Chief, JHALSA
It is a matter of great contentment that Jharkhand State Legal Services Authority is publishing this Special Issue of Nyaya Dagar (2014-2016), Which is yet another step matching its objectives and commitments for ensuring Access to Justice to women, children, victims of undeserved want and most marginalized sections of society. As we all know that Legal Services Institutions should work as one stop centre for redressal of all kinds of grievances and JHALSA is taking sincere efforts to achieve this goal. Through its resources, JHALSA must act first at the time of human tragedies and Natural calamities. This issue of Nyaya Dagar throws light over the delightful journey and achievements that have been scaled by JHALSA from 2014 to 2016. Though lots of work has been done, but we should not be complacent and strive hard to wipe the tears of all tearful eyes. It is also a matter of satisfaction that JHALSA is playing a vital role in combating with the menace of Witchcraft practices prevailing in the state.
Before parting with, I would like to express my confidence in the working of Jharkhand State Legal Services Authority with more results in future by extending help to yet many more people in need delivering justice at their door steps.

The Popular conception of Legal Services Institution is that court fees and services of Panel Lawyers are provided free of cost to women, children, differently abled persons, victims of undeserved want and marginalized sections of society.
But the dimension of activities has expanded manyfolds. Now it has emerged as one stop centre for redressal of all type of grievances. With the Launch of Seven Schemes of NALSA our responsibility has increased tremendously. Jharkhand State Legal Services Authority has always remained in the forefront in implementing the various schemes of NALSA by reaching out benefits to the People for whom the same is targeted for.
Past is always capable of showing us our weakness and strength as also as to how to work better.
With immense pleasure we are coming up with the Special Issue of Nyaya Dagar (2014-2016), an official Newsletter of Jharkhand State Legal Services Authority so that everybody may benefit from our work and experience.
